Benefits of Adult Bunk Beds
Adult bunk beds provide several benefits over conventional sleeping arrangements:
Space-Saving: By stacking beds vertically, bunk beds can inhabit much less flooring location compared to side-by-side twin beds or bigger singles. This is especially advantageous in small studios, visitor rooms, or office with limited square video.
Cost-Effective: Purchasing a bunk bed typically shows more economical than buying separate beds, specifically when considering the savings on bed frames, mattresses, and bedding.

Style Considerations for Adult Bunk Beds
When choosing an adult bunk bed, several aspects must be taken into account:
Height and Accessibility: Ensure the bunk bed's overall height and specific bed risers allow easy entry and exit, especially if residents have mobility issues.
Strength and Safety: Look for sturdy buildings with safe ladder attachments and guardrails to avoid falls. Sturdy bed frames and solid bed mattress are also important for a comfortable night's sleep.
Storage and Organization: Consider the readily available space beneath the lower bed and how it can be utilized for storage. Drawers, racks, or cabinets can help keep clutter at bay and maintain a tidy living environment.
Bed Mattress Quality and Size: Choose top quality, breathable bed mattress in the suitable sizes for each bed (twin, complete, queen, etc). Guarantee the mattresses are comfortable and supportive for a relaxing sleep.
Design and Aesthetics: Select a bunk bed that balances with the wanted room design and color scheme. Consider the general visual effect, in addition to the ease of cleansing and upkeep.
